Зачем размещать сокращатель ссылок на собственном сервере?

Преимущества размещения сокращателя ссылок на сервере

24 октября 2025
6 мин.
15
24 октября 2025

«Однажды он заметил, что клиенты перестали доверять коротким ссылкам в письмах — и это изменило всё». Такое начало часто встречается в разговорах с CTO, маркетологами и владельцами малого бизнеса, когда возникает вопрос: Зачем размещать сокращатель ссылок на собственном сервере. В этом тексте специалист делится опытом и аргументами — не как догмат, а как практическое руководство, которое помогает понять технологическую эволюцию и ценности бренда.

Контекст: почему тема актуальна именно сейчас

В последние годы внимание к контролю над данными и репутацией бренда выросло. Короткие ссылки перестали быть просто удобством — они стали частью коммуникации, аналитики и безопасности. На фоне высоких ожиданий пользователей, ужесточения правил обработки персональных данных и роста количества фишинговых атак, компаниям важно решать: доверить сокращение ссылок стороннему сервису или разместить сокращатель ссылок на собственном сервере.

Что значит «размещать сокращатель ссылок на собственном сервере»

Под этим понимается развёртывание программного решения для сокращения URL на инфраструктуре, которую контролирует организация: её домены, виртуальные машины, контейнеры или облачные учётные записи. Это может быть самостоятельный сервис с открытым исходным кодом или кастомная разработка, интегрированная с API, CRM и системой аналитики.

Преимущества: почему компании выбирают собственный сокращатель

Когда команда решает разместить сокращатель ссылок на собственном сервере, её руководят несколько ключевых мотивов:

1) Контроль над брендом

  • Кастомный домен: короткие ссылки выглядят надёжнее, если они связаны с корпоративным доменом, а не с третьим сервисом.
  • Единый стиль коммуникации: ссылка становится частью брендированного опыта — это влияет на кликабельность и доверие.

2) Конфиденциальность и соответствие законам

  • Данные о переходах остаются в пределах инфраструктуры компании, что облегчает соблюдение требований Федерального закона №152-ФЗ и GDPR.
  • Отсутствие передачи логов и аналитики третьим лицам снижает риск утечки персональных данных.

3) Безопасность

  • Возможность внедрять встроенную фильтрацию фишинга, проверку на вредоносные домены и защиту от массовых автоматизированных запросов.
  • Контроль политик редиректов, сроков жизни ссылок и механизмов блокировки по географии или IP.

4) Продвинутая аналитика

  • Гибкая интеграция с системами аналитики, хранение данных о кликах, UTM-метках и пользовательских атрибутах.
  • Возможность хранить подробную историю переходов и строить собственные метрики эффективности ссылок.

5) Масштабируемость и производительность

  • Контроль за инфраструктурой позволяет настроить кеширование, балансировку нагрузки и горизонтальное масштабирование в зависимости от трафика.
  • Оптимизация задержек может повысить конверсию в рекламных кампаниях и CRM-цепочках.

6) API и интеграции

  • Собственный API даёт гибкость для автоматизации массового создания ссылок, интеграции с маркетинговыми инструментами и сервисами рассылок.

Техническая эволюция: от простых редиректов до микросервисов

Классический сокращатель — это простой перенаправитель: короткий путь принимает запрос и возвращает Location с 301/302. Но практика показала, что потребности растут:

  1. На начальном этапе достаточно статических редиректов и небольших таблиц в базе данных.
  2. Дальше приходят аналитика, UTM, A/B-тесты и кастомные правила — возникает потребность в очередях и хранении событий.
  3. При высоких нагрузках и распределённой архитектуре сокращатель превращается в набор микросервисов: генерация ссылок, трансляция/редирект, сбор событий, API для клиентов, админ-панель и система репликации.

Эволюция архитектуры — не дань моде, а ответ на требования безопасности, масштабируемости и интеграции с брендом.

Как выбрать архитектуру и стек

При выборе архитектуры важно смотреть на требования бизнеса, не гоняться за «идеальным стеком». Специалист обычно рассматривает следующие варианты.

Монолит против микросервисов

  • Монолит проще запускать и тестировать для небольших команд.
  • Микросервисы дают гибкость и лучшую масштабируемость, но увеличивают сложность эксплуатации и мониторинга.

Языки и фреймворки

  • Go и Node.js часто выбирают за производительность и малые задержки.
  • Python/Django и Ruby on Rails удобны для быстрой разработки и прототипирования.

Хранилище и кеширование

  • PostgreSQL или MySQL для постоянного хранения ссылок и метаданных.
  • Redis для кеширования сопоставлений короткий->длинный и хранения счётчиков.

Инфраструктура

  • Контейнеры (Docker) и оркестрация (Kubernetes) для управления масштабируемостью.
  • CDN и edge-редиректы для снижения задержки в глобальном масштабе.

Важно: команда должна учитывать масштабируемость с самого начала — позже миграция на распределённую архитектуру обойдётся дороже.

Бренд, UX и SEO: почему это влияет на трафик

Ссылка — это не просто технический объект, это часть пользовательского опыта. Когда сокращатель использует корпоративный домен и читаемые сокращения, клиенты охотнее кликают. Кроме того, корректная настройка редиректов и роботов позволяет поисковым системам правильно индексировать страницы — это важно для SEO.

Маркетолог отмечает, что в рекламных кампаниях URL со знакомым доменом повышает CTR на нескольких процентах, что при больших объёмах трафика даёт значимый прирост. Также собственный сокращатель облегчает работу с UTM-метками и атрибуцией конверсий.

Безопасность, конфиденциальность и соответствие законам

Собственный сервис предоставляет возможности для соблюдения юридических требований и внедрения безопасных практик:

  • Шифрование логов и хранилищ на уровне сервера.
  • Ретеншн-политики: как долго хранить события переходов.
  • Механизмы обнаружения аномалий: защита от ботов и DDoS.
  • Проактивный контроль над рисками фишинга: возможность мгновенно деактивировать подозрительные короткие ссылки.

Кроме того, размещение внутри России может быть важным для соответствия требованиям локального законодательства (например, ФЗ-152). Для работы с клиентами из Европейского союза стоит учитывать требования GDPR.

Как измерять успех: метрики и аналитика

Наличие собственного сокращателя открывает доступ к метрикам, которые ранее были привязаны к сторонним сервисам или недоступны вовсе. Важные показатели:

  • CTR по каждой ссылке и кампании.
  • Конверсия от клика к целевому действию.
  • География и время кликов.
  • Качество трафика: процент отказов и глубина сессии после перехода.
  • Процент блокировок/фишинговых срабатываний.

Собранные данные можно использовать для оптимизации рекламных расходов, персонализации сообщений и улучшения UX.

Частые ошибки и риски при запуске

Даже технически грамотные команды совершают типичные ошибки:

  1. Недооценка нагрузки и отсутствие подготовки к пиковым событиям.
  2. Плохая стратегия резервного копирования и восстановления.
  3. Игнорирование защиты от автоматизированных запросов (ботов), что ведёт к фальшивым метрикам.
  4. Слабая архивация логов или хранение лишних персональных данных, создающее риски соответствия.
  5. Отсутствие плана деградации: если сервис недоступен, нужно обработать редиректы корректно, чтобы не потерять трафик.

Ключевая мысль: лучше предусмотреть простую, но надёжную базовую архитектуру и расширять её по мере роста требований.

План развертывания: шаг за шагом

Практический план помогает перейти от идеи к рабочему сервису без лишнего риска. Специалист предлагает такой порядок действий:

  1. Определение требований: нагрузки, интеграции, политика хранения данных и требования безопасности.
  2. Выбор стека: язык, БД, кеш, инфраструктура.
  3. Прототип: монолитная версия с минимумом функций: генерация, редирект, логирование базовой метрики.
  4. Тестирование нагрузки: прогон сценариев пикового трафика и тесты отказоустойчивости.
  5. Интеграция аналитики: достоверные UTM-метки, события и отчёты.
  6. Внедрение безопасности: защита от ботов, WAF, SSL, мониторинг.
  7. Пилот с брендовым доменом: запуск для ограниченного круга кампаний.
  8. Итеративное улучшение: добавление API, админ-панели, A/B тестов.

Кейсы, источники и примеры

Реальные примеры помогают понять выгоды и подводные камни.

  • Крупные компании предпочитают собственные сокращатели для защиты бренда и гибкости аналитики (см. кейсы в маркетинговых отчётах таких платформ, как Bitly и внутренняя практика крупных ecommerce-игроков).
  • Малые команды нередко начинают с open-source решений (например, YOURLS) и затем переносят логи и функциональность в собственную инфраструктуру.
«Сокращатель ссылок — это не про удобство, это про ответственность за коммуникацию», — отмечает один из технических директоров компании, внедривших собственный сервис.

Полезные источники для изучения:

  • YOURLS — проект с открытым кодом для запуска собственного сокращателя (репозиторий и документация).
  • Статьи и отчёты Bitly о трендах в ссылочном трафике (история отрасли и практики безопасности).
  • Практики по защите приложений: OWASP, рекомендации по API-авторизации и хранению логов.

Примечание: перечисленные проекты и ресурсы служат отправной точкой; каждая команда адаптирует решения под свои требования.

Ключевые выводы и заключение

Подводя итоги, специалист формулирует основные тезисы, которые помогают понять, зачем размещать сокращатель ссылок на собственном сервере и как это сделать правильно.

  • Контроль бренда: собственный домен повышает доверие и CTR.
  • Безопасность и конфиденциальность: внутренняя инфраструктура облегчает соблюдение законодательства и уменьшает риски утечек.
  • Аналитика: прямой доступ к данным позволяет строить точную атрибуцию и оптимизировать кампании с учётом UTM-меток.
  • Техническая эволюция: от простого редиректа до микросервисной архитектуры — развитие идёт по мере роста требований.
  • Правильный выбор стека и план развертывания минимизируют риски и затраты на последующую миграцию.
  • Ошибки обходятся дорого: недооценка нагрузки, отсутствие резервных сценариев и слабая защита приводят к потере доверия.
  • API и интеграции позволяют автоматизировать процессы и встраивать сокращатель в маркетинговые цепочки.
  • Масштабируемость должна учитываться с момента архитектурного проектирования, иначе расходы на рефакторинг возрастут.
  • Собственный сокращатель — это инвестиция в брендовые ценности и технологическую независимость, которая окупается при грамотной реализации.

Эта тема — пример того, как технологические решения и ценности бренда переплетаются: решение о размещении сервиса на собственном сервере — не чисто техническое, а стратегическое. При правильном подходе организация получает не только инструмент для укороченных ссылок, но и платформу для контроля коммуникаций, аналитики и укрепления доверия клиентов.

Источники

  • YOURLS — проект с открытым кодом для коротких ссылок (репозиторий и документация).
  • Bitly — отчёты по ссылочному трафику и лучшим практикам безопасности (открытые исследования рынка).
  • OWASP — рекомендации по защите веб-приложений и API.
  • RFC 3986 — спецификация универсальных идентификаторов ресурсов (URI).
  • Федеральный закон №152-ФЗ «О персональных данных» и регламенты GDPR — для вопросов соответствия.
Вопросы-ответы